Just days after Splatoon Raiders launched, the Switch 2 game managed to reach the top spot on the UK software sales charts ending for the week of July 25, 2026. Although the Splatoon franchise is mostly known as a multiplayer shooter series, the newest spin-off, Splatoon Raiders, is seemingly making a name for itself as it starts to appear on sales charts.

Following the massive success that was Splatoon 3, many fans were surprised to see that Splatoon Raiders intended to take the franchise in a different direction. After being surprise revealed in the Nintendo Today app, the spin-off game showcased the Deep Cut trio seemingly being stranded on a mysterious island chain following a helicopter crash. Landing on the Spirhalite Islands, players would team up with Deep Cut to find treasure in a primarily single-player adventure. Despite making such a big shift away from the competitive multiplayer gameplay that the franchise is known for, it seems like Splatoon Raiders is turning into a big success.
